Safety Specialists/Coordinators in Marion, Florida play a vital role in ensuring workplace safety. They implement and enforce safety regulations, conduct risk assessments, and provide training to employees. Responsibilities include investigating accidents, maintaining safety records, and developing emergency response plans.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Safety Specialists/Coordinators in Marion, Florida play a crucial role in ensuring workplace safety and compliance with regulations. - Entry-level Safety Specialist salaries range from $40,000 to $50,000 per year - Mid-career Safety Coordinator salaries range from $50,000 to $65,000 per year - Senior-level Safety Manager salaries range from $65,000 to $85,000 per year The role of Safety Specialist/Coordinator in Marion, Florida has a rich history dating back to the industrial revolution, where worker safety became a major concern in factories and manufacturing plants. Over time, the position has evolved to encompass not only physical safety but also mental health and well-being in the workplace. Safety Specialists/Coordinators now work closely with management to develop comprehensive safety programs and training initiatives. Current trends in the field of Safety Specialist/Coordinator in Marion, Florida include the integration of technology for safety monitoring, emphasis on mental health awareness, and the implementation of proactive safety measures to prevent accidents and injuries.
